Lesefelder, erlaubte Länge

JVerein-Benutzer diskutieren über Erweiterungswünsche

Moderator: heiner

Antworten
vof
Beiträge: 12
Registriert: Freitag 8. April 2022, 10:52
Verein: Behindertensportgemeinschaft Mönchengladbach e. V.
Mitglieder: 120
JVerein-Version: 2.8.18 20190623 b521 db 417
Betriebssystem: Win10 MySQL

Lesefelder, erlaubte Länge

Beitrag von vof »

Hallo miteinander!

Wir organisieren in unserem Verein ReHa-Sport auf ärztliche Verordnung und rechnen die ReHa-Übungen mit den Abrechnungsstellen der Krankenkassen ab. Daraus entsteht der der Anwendungsfall, daß eine Rechnung mit den abzurechnenden Übungseinheiten (als Daten in Eigenschaften/Zusatzfeldern des Adresstyps Verordnungsteilnehmer) an die Abrechnungsstelle der Krankenkasse des Übungsteilnehmers (als Datum des Adresstyps Abrechnungsstelle) geschrieben werden soll. Programmatisch würde ich das über Lesefelder lösen wollen, mit Code wie:

Code: Alles auswählen

DBIterator list = Einstellungen.getDBService().createList( Mitglied.class );
list.addFilter( "id = ?", new Object[] { mitglied_id } );
...
DBIterator list = Einstellungen.getDBService().createList( Adresstyp.class );
Ich erhalte beim Speichern die Fehlermeldung "Skript kann nicht gespeichert werden" und dazu im Log

Code: Alles auswählen

Caused by: com.mysql.jdbc.MysqlDataTruncation: Data truncation: Data too long for column 'script' at row 1
Die Spaltenlänge der Spalte script ist auf 1.000 Zeichen begrenzt. Unter Windows konnte ich mit der MySQL Workbench 8.0 CE die Spaltenlänge ändern.

1. Frage: Spricht etwas dagegen, die Spaltenlänge auf 10.000 zu setzen?
2. Frage: Hat jemand eine Idee, warum die Änderung der Spalteneinstellung unter Linux mit LibreOffice/JDBC nach https://doku.jverein.de/allgemein/libreofficedb nicht funktioniert? Lesezugriff geht, aber die Einstellungen sind ausgegraut.

Danke für Eure Hilfe und ein schönes Wochenende
Volker
vof
Beiträge: 12
Registriert: Freitag 8. April 2022, 10:52
Verein: Behindertensportgemeinschaft Mönchengladbach e. V.
Mitglieder: 120
JVerein-Version: 2.8.18 20190623 b521 db 417
Betriebssystem: Win10 MySQL

Re: Lesefelder, erlaubte Länge

Beitrag von vof »

Die Änderung der Spaltengröße gelang mit http://squirrel-sql.sourceforge.net/.
Antworten